William S Jr Rolley 1917 - 1996

William S Rolley of San Mateo, San Mateo County, CA was born on September 22, 1917, and died at age 79 years old on November 7, 1996. William Rolley was buried at San Joaquin Valley National Cemetery Section 9 Site 435 32053 West Mccabe Road, in Santa Nella.

Did you know?
In 1917, in the year that William S Jr Rolley was born, on July 28, between ten and fifteen thousand blacks silently walked down New York City's Fifth Avenue to protest racial discrimination and violence. Lynchings in Waco Texas and hundreds of African-Americans killed in East St. Louis Illinois had sparked the protest. Picket signs said "Mother, do lynchers go to heaven?" "Mr. President, why not make America safe for democracy?" "Thou shalt not kill." "Pray for the Lady Macbeth's of East St. Louis" and "Give us a chance to live."
Did you know?
In 1926, he was merely 9 years old when on November 15th, NBC was founded. It was the U.S.'s first major broadcast network. Ownership of the network was split between RCA (a majority partner at 50%), its founding corporate parent General Electric (which owned 30%), and Westinghouse (which owned the remaining 20%).
